Just installed Windows XP Service Pack 2. I have set up two user
accounts - 1 X administrator, 1 X restricted access. Can I set things up
so the computer always boots as the administrator? The other account
will only be used occasionally.

Also, when I come back after leaving the computer idle for some time, it
brings up the user account window and asks me to select the user and
enter my password again. Can i stop this?
